Abstract
Measurements of at GeV are compared. The data are taken under identical conditions utilizing clean proton-proton collisions from the CERN intersecting storage rings and confirm scaling to 5%. The observed yield is a factor of 1.6±0.2 larger than estimated from a simple parton model but is consistent with QCD. The dependence of the muon pairs agrees well with expectations from QCD.
